Saturday, January 31, 2004, by Pastor Dave Sonnenberg
Bible text:
Acts 12:24-13:15
Most of us keep very busy. Our daily journeys take us running from here to
there. Our palm pilots and calendars fill up. We are people usually on the
move. We talk a lot about the need to slow down, but people need reason to
slow down in the first place.
I am drawn in to the final verse in the text today - where a group simply says to
Paul, “brothers, if you have a message of encouragement, please speak.” I think
that is a verse that Christians today need to keep at the forefront of their
thinking. There is so much lamenting being offered about the state of the
world. Many Christians, whether they mean to or not, spend a lot of time
commenting on all the evils of the world. They offer the world the doom and
gloom, yet not always the grace of God. The grace of God is offered as a mere
footnote. If we truly want to help enrich the world around us, we need to give
people radical reason to stop, look, and listen.
I believe the world around us is saying the same thing today as the people were
saying to Paul - “Christian, give us a message of encouragement.” Will we dare
to tell people- “the God of the universe is madly in love with you?” Will we
dare tell people - “Come as you are right now. Don’t wait until you think your
life is sanitized and in good order.”?
I find that one of the things that encourages me the most is when someone admits
that they are flawed, yet in all they say and do, they exhibit that they are
truly trying to grow as a follower of Jesus. To me, that is good stuff. I want
to be around people who hunger to grow, not hunger to be perfect. Only God is
perfect.
Your life is a daily opportunity to offer spiritual encouragement. When the
world around you asks for it (which they are doing 24x7x365), do your best to
rise to the occasion and give them a message of grace. Do your best to stop
lamenting and start serving up large doses of encouragement. Lift up those
around you. Don’t be afraid to fail. In all - remember that you serve the God
of the universe, who embraces you and loves you and wants you in a close
relationship.
Lord God, the world around us is hungering for words of encouragement. Lead us
by your Spirit so we offer the world what you desire. Teach us to value our
every action and every word. Mold us in your thoughts. Mold us in your ways so
that we offer this world and encouraging voice. Amen.
